Escape to Tavaita Cottage, a one-of-a-kind retreat bursting with creativity, character, and charm. Newly renovated and refreshed, this unique collection of handcrafted cabins offers a memorable stay for couples, families, and friends seeking something a little different from the ordinary.

Perfectly positioned within walking distance of the Hauraki Rail Trail, swimming holes, and scenic walking tracks, Tavaita Cottage is an ideal base for exploring the natural beauty and outdoor adventures of the Hauraki region.

Thoughtfully updated while retaining its quirky personality, the cottage now features a refreshed interior, renovated kitchen, and a private rear deck complete with a beautifully restored outdoor claw-foot bath.

## The Space

**Please read the full description before booking.**

Tavaita Cottage is not a hotel, luxury lodge, or standard holiday home. It is a collection of character-filled cabins lovingly created over time, with handcrafted details, eclectic décor, and plenty of personality. Some finishes are rustic and unconventional, which is all part of its charm. If you appreciate unique spaces with soul and don't mind a few imperfections, you'll feel right at home.

Located alongside our family home, Tavaita Cottage consists of three separate but connected cabin spaces, creating a flexible and memorable accommodation experience.

### Lounge Cabin

The heart of the cottage is the cosy lounge cabin, a warm and inviting space to relax after a day of exploring. A wood burner and oil heater keep things comfortable during the cooler months, while large bi-fold doors open onto the outdoor entertaining area.

For evenings spent unwinding, you'll find books, board games, a CD player with a selection of music, and even a ukulele available for guests to enjoy.

One thing you won't find here is Wi-Fi. Tavaita Cottage is the perfect place to disconnect from screens, slow down, and reconnect with nature, conversation, and simple pleasures. Mobile phone coverage is available, allowing you to stay connected when needed while still enjoying a relaxed digital detox experience.

Outside, guests can enjoy a Weber BBQ, picnic table, and garden setting perfect for long summer evenings.

### Loft Cabin

Adjacent to the lounge is the loft cabin, featuring two single beds on the lower level and a double bed on the mezzanine level, accessed via a ladder. A fireplace provides additional warmth and atmosphere during cooler weather.

Please note that during winter the cabins can take around 45 minutes to warm up. If you're arriving later in the evening and we're home, we're happy to light the fire for you before arrival.

### Bula Room Cabin

The separate Bula Room offers a comfortable queen-sized bed and oil heater, creating a cosy and private retreat after a day spent cycling, swimming, or exploring.

### Bathroom & Outdoor Bath

The bathroom facilities are accessed via the rear deck and include a shower and toilet.

A guest favourite is the newly upgraded private rear deck, screened for privacy and designed for relaxation. Here you'll find a beautifully restored claw-foot outdoor bath—perfect for soaking under the stars after a day on the trail.

### Sleeping Arrangements

We prepare beds according to the number of guests booked. Please let us know your preferred bed configuration when making your reservation.

For bookings of four guests, two guests will need to share a bed. If you'd like all four beds made up, an additional linen fee of $15 applies.

## Other Things to Note

* Our family home is located beside the cottage, and the driveway passes near the accommodation.
* The property is not suitable for parties, events, or large gatherings.
* During summer, friends and family may occasionally visit our property, and we sometimes host guests in another cabin elsewhere on the grounds. The atmosphere is relaxed, friendly, and holiday-park-like rather than completely secluded.
* While the cottage can accommodate up to six guests, the living and outdoor spaces are most comfortable for groups of up to four.
* Ceiling heights in the lounge, loft cabin, and kitchen are low. Taller guests may need to duck in places—think cosy hobbit cottage rather than grand manor.
* During periods of heavy rain, some water may enter around the kitchen lean-to and fireplaces. The rear deck can also become slippery, so please take care and use the anti-slip surfaces provided.
* During winter, the wood burner is essential for heating the lounge and loft cabin.
* We have a small, friendly dog who may stop by to say hello.
* Being in a semi-rural environment, occasional insects and other critters are part of country living.
* The garage beside the cottage serves as the depot for our family business and may occasionally be accessed by staff.
